Ok guys, here's what's up. I am using my laptop to connect to a wireless router that is connected to the internet. What I am trying to accomplish is to have my Xbox360 to connect through the internet through my laptop using ICS, but the xbox can't connect to the internet. The laptop is on Vista Home Premium 32bit. Windows Firewall has been turned off completely while testing, the comp. does have nortons so I disabled it from turning on at startup and it is not running. I have read these forums and it seems no one has an exact answer to this problem, but I'm going to try and see if mine is different. There are a few places I think the hold up could be at... 1: At the manage network connections page it shows the wireless NIc connected to internet, should I be clicking its properties and then going to sharing and enabling it? (i have it enabled on the connection the 360 is plugged to, the wired LAN) because there is no sharing tab under the wireless NIC that acually has the internet connection. I enabled sharing on the LAN NIC that is free(the one the xbox360 is connected to). 2: It is showing my LAN(xbox360 connection) as " 'unidentified network', shared ". All connections are set to private network. under status it shows sent packets, but no received packets. i click diagnose and repair and try to make it autoassign new IP, and even reset network adapter, doesn't help. I have updated both NIC's driver's, they are current. here is my ipconfig /all as well.... ALL help is GREATLY appreciated!! Ok I have a 360 and have it configured the same way in vista. Turn the 360
off. After you share the wireless connection to the LAN it should give it the ip of 192.168.0.1. You need to change that to 192.168.0.2 for it to work for some reason. Then after that is done turn the 360 back on and you should have a connection. And I have had problems with Mcaffee firewall if you have that. "Keithl322" wrote: Ok guys, here's what's up.
